AirServer, the company that essentially transforms console and mobile phones into an AirPlay server, now allows the availability of AirServer for the Xbox One after its recent update. In the past, Apple's AirPlay feature made it possible for iPhone, iPad and Mac users to stream video and audio from their devices to Apple TVs and other supported devices.

The recent update gave Xbox One players the ability to stream audio in the background from their iOS devices or Mac while using Xbox, or alternatively, mirror the entire display to stream mobile games or video to the big screen, 9to5Mac reported.

In the AirServer website, the application specifies that Xbox One can bring multi-room AirPlay audio support through a set of AirPlay speakers connected with iTunes.

Through AirServer's already popular screen mirroring capabilities for sending content from one device to another using various standards, AirPlay transforms Xbox One into a high performance receiver where users can mirror their favorite games or apps with buttery smooth performance.

Similar Apple devices such as iPhone, iPad and Mac have already been touched by AirPlay during its previous updates. Now, Apple allows iOS device users to AirPlay photos and videos to a second-gen Apple TV or later, or music to an Apple TV, AirPlay speaker, or AirPort Express. Users can also mirror the entire display of their iOS device to an Apple TV for full viewing of games and movies.

Together with the update, AirServer for Mac, PC, and Windows 10 now supports Google Cast receiving capabilities free-of-charge to all the application's existing customers. AirServer also lets users transmit via Google Cast and Miracast.

Pratik Kumar and his wife Kristín ósk óskars founded "App Dynamic," the creator for AirServer, in 2011. AirServer is a European success story, gaining worldwide market leadership in screen casting solutions, which caught the attention of students and professors with its core focus as a tool for classrooms.

Now, AirServer marks the pioneer in screen projection technology and supports all 3 major industry standard protocols in screen mirroring: AirPlay, Miracast and Google Cast. Its main software architecture is to transform any computer or application into a universal mirroring receiver.
